The age (in years) of a population is normally distributed with a mean of 36 and standard deviation of 12. The height (in cm) of the same population is also normally distributed with a mean of 160 and standard deviation of 10.
If the probability of age greater than 50 years is equal to the probability of height greater than h, the value of h (in cm) is ______ (rounded off to two decimal places).

Correct : 171.67
